10 Video Games With Excellent Gameplay (That Still Disappointed)

When everything other than gameplay is a letdown.

Video games have to master everything they set out to accomplish to be considered firm masterpieces but sometimes a game absolutely nails one aspect but misses the mark on a few others.

It can be disappointing to see a game excel at its core mechanics but fumble in areas like world building, narrative, or replayability.

The games on this list all have incredible core gameplay loops and, in some cases, even mechanics that marked the height of their respective franchises. Unfortunately, they dropped the ball elsewhere and managed to disappoint players.
